Output 5f78d260a04bcbec419a4e0a7d0b04dc2e65a20ee9123ee05c22b2dfe0a43b3d:0

value
385395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3d3a1c393067cf967ed5c453aff1f866716b25a OP_EQUAL
address
3J5rQKgcEwmixzDp8MfAUgccD5iTuPfsvt
transaction
5f78d260a04bcbec419a4e0a7d0b04dc2e65a20ee9123ee05c22b2dfe0a43b3d
confirmations
72595
spent
true